Abstract: Objective To investigate the role of nitric oxide synthase (NOS) in the pathogenesis of acute lung injury induced by hyperoxia. Methods Seventy - two mice were exposed to oxygen (for 24 to 72 h) in sealed cages >95%, the severity of lung injury was evaluated, the expression of iNOS and eNOS in lung tissue at 24,48 and 72 hours of hyperoxia were studied by immunohistochemistry (IHC). Results Acute lung injury was caused hyperoxia,accompanied by increased total cell, macrophage and neutrophil counts in BALF. IHG study showed iNOS and eNOS protein were mainly localized in the cytoplasm of airway epithelial cells, alveolar macrophages and vascular smooth muscle cells. The expression of iNOS and eNOS protein in airway epithelium increased greatly in hyperoxia- induced lung injury. Conclusion NOS played an important role in the development of hyperoxia - induced lung injury in mice lung.
